Transaction

5583a68a96fc0b56f797943efe2cac14ceea555bfebd61e03c705b3f821efea9
466,389 confirmations
Timestamp
1498639005
Block473,223
Fee67,500 sats
Fee rate298.7 sats/vB
view on mempool.space

Inputs & Outputs